Odfjell Technology is looking for an Operational Purchaser to fill a permanent position in our team. The successful candidate will be a part of SCM and a dynamic team of Operational Purchasers. He or she will also work closely with our internal customers.  

Key performance responsibilities: 
Perform purchases according to approved requisitions  
Identify suppliers, obtain quotations and negotiate terms of purchase 
Manage change orders and follow up pending deliveries  
Ensure effective expediting and tracking of goods and shipments  
Monitor and verify cost related to purchase orders  
Contribute to the development of supplier relations 
Follow up vendors on a secondary level 
Facilitate payment of invoices within time limit  
Contribute to reduced operating expenses (OPEX) and capital expenditures (CAPEX)   
Ensure sourcing strategies are in alignment with company goals and objectives  
Contribute to provide excellent customer service and close working relationships
